    Hillary Bows Out of Iran Protest After Palin Invited

    Hillary Clinton has canceled a scheduled appearance at an anti-Iran protest during the UN General Assembly next week after learning GOP VP candidate Gov. Sarah Palin had also been invited and was planning to attend.

    "Her attendance was news to us, and this was never billed to us as a partisan political event," said Clinton spokesman Philippe Reines. "Sen. Clinton will therefore not be attending."
